Hi Richard Yeah thats true. it costs me £1100 a year to insure it. Do you know what might cause the signals to stop working? Because they have completely stopped theres no clicking sound or the flashing arrows dont come on. I can't drive it at the minute .

Is everything else working ok? If so it is probably the fuse. If you check the fusebox you should find a fuse for the indicators and if you pull it out look at the metal strip running between the two pegs, this should be joined up.
